Cambridge, MA & Providence, RI – The Wagner College women's water polo team earned three victories at the Harvard Invitational this weekend hosted by Harvard and Brown.
Wagner dropped its fourth game of the season in the opening game of the weekend to Harvard, 11-7.
Graduate student
Malia Josephson and senior
Abbey Simshauser combined for four of the seven goals for Wagner in the contest as both players tallied two goals each.
Wagner got its first win of the weekend with a 20-1 win over Gannon. In two games this season against Gannon, the Seahawks have outscored the Golden Knights 40-6.
Malia Josephson tallied a team-high three goals against Gannon while junior
Mar Navarro and sophomore
Carlota Alonso chipped in two goals each.
On Sunday, Wagner opened the day with a 20-4 win over the Redlands. Sophomore
Lizzy Koerper and freshman
Magali Ogg netted four goals each while
Mar Navarro tallied a hat trick in the contest.
In the final game of the weekend, Wagner earned a 12-5 win over Brown. The Seahawks capitalized on opportunities early in the contest as they outscored Brown 5-0 in the first half. Five different goal scorers found the back of the net in the first half as
Malia Josephson,
Abbey Simshauser,
Mar Navarro,
Carlota Alonso and junior
Andrea Arias scored goals.
Wagner continued its momentum in the third quarter as they outscored Brown 4-1.
Malia Josephson netted two goals in the frame as
Mar Navarro and
Andrea Arias tallied one goal each in the frame.
Despite being outscored 4-3 in the fourth quarter, the Green & White were able to hold on for the victory.
Wagner will begin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ference (MAAC) play on Saturday, March 18 when they welcome VMI to the Spiro Sports Center. The Green & White will then welcome La Salle and Villanova on Sunday, March 19. The Seahawks enter conference play with a 17-4 overall record with one more non-conference contest remaining.
